The Carolina Panthers placed quarterback Cam Newton on season-ending injured reserve Tuesday with a nagging foot injury.

Newton suffered the injury in the preseason and aggravated it during the second week of the regular season. Newton, the 2015 NFL MVP will miss the final eight games of the season, including two games in a four-week span against the Falcons.
